hope this hasnt been posted already, its currently a bit difficult to keep track of all GSX L2 issues posted here ;)
GSX sometimes bugs out and doesnt show custom Jetway1 unless i restart COUATL. Here's an example from Terminal E at LSZH, i've configured 2 jetways and both work properly. This also happens with single jetway gates, which means that no jetway will be shown at all.
First 2 screens show how it should be, 3rd and 4th screen show situation after GSX bugs out:

I've seen the same thing. For example I set up dual gates at KORD C16, then in a new P3D session I started at C16 with a PMDG B744 and did normal preflight and both gates normal. Then on GSX pushback, I looked at the gate area and Jetway 1 was missing.
The next day I start investigating and learning more about the various jetway options and I notice Jetway 1 missing again, so I start new session and it's there again.
I also notice that when setting the color attribute to bridges that quite often setting Jetway 1 bridge white then setting Jetway 2 bridge white changes Jetway 1 bridge to default. It may have something to do with Save button but I'm not sure. Still learning.
